Alcanza is a growing multi-site, multi-phase clinical research company with a network of locations in AL, AZ, FL, GA, IL, MA, MI, MO, NV, SC, TX, VA, and Puerto Rico. We have established a strong presence across Phase I-IV studies and several therapeutic areas including vaccine, neurology, dermatology, psychiatry, and general medicine. Join us as we continue to grow. The Patient Recruiter is responsible for planning, organizing, and implementing recruitment programs to successfully meet targeted enrollment goals for study protocols and enroll appropriate subjects in protocols.

Key Responsibilities

Essential Job Duties:
  • Ability to phone screen patients or caregivers in caring and empathetic manner.
  • Document patient information correctly in the computer database
  • Schedule/reschedule patient screen and prescreen appointments.
  • Manage incoming calls from patients interested in taking part in research studies.
  • Evaluate eligibility of potential subjects through methods such as screening interviews, reviews of medical records, or discussions with site clinic staff.
  • Learn and maintain knowledge regarding clinical research studies including inclusion and exclusion criteria for different studies.
  • Record contact status of patients and document information in the database.
  • Review, call and update sponsor patient portals as needed.
  • Perform all other duties that may be requested or assigned.
